"A grand manor
home on an equally beautiful estate. This residence with its
great barn, ponds and ancillary buildings is being developed on
166 acres to be New Jersey's largest thoroughbred race horse
breeding facility. The exterior has been fashioned in Jerusalem
stone, slate and mahogany. An enormous English conservatory
anchors one end of the home while a driveway through the
porte-cochere leads guests to a balustrade pool plaza and formal
geometric gardens. Sweeping vistas of fenced Kentucky blue
grass paddocks greet the eye from every room."
Jack Wright, Polo Architectural Designer
